Installation Manual Solar Water Heater Evacuated U-Tube Split System Split (Indirect) Solar Water System Split (Indirect) Solar Water System Installation Manual: This manual explains how to install a system of evacuated tubes with the collector panels separated from the storage tank. Systems described use Freefuelforever evacuated tube collectors, either for service hot water or swimming pool heating. In the case of swimming pool heating, locations that never freeze may forgo the solar hot water tank, the heat exchanger and expansion vessel. Any location that freezes or has minerals in the water should use a heat exchanger to avoid collector damage....

The Solar System (A) Use the glossary on the back of this reading for the underlined words. ! The words...The words "solar system" refer to the Sun and all of the objects that travel around it. These objects include planets, natural satellites such as the Moon, the asteroid belt, comets and meteoroids Our solar system has an elliptical shape. The Sun is the center of the solar system. It contains 99.8% of all of the mass in our solar system. Consequently, it exerts a tremendous gravitational pull on planets, satellites, asteroids, comets, and meteoroids. The planets and their satellites orbit the sun at different periods of revolution. A period of revolution is directly related to a planet’s distance from the sun. As distance decreases, the period of revolution decreases. Therefore, a year length is different for each planet. In addition, planets also rotate on their axis at different speeds. A planets length of day and night is related to it’s speed of rotation. The slower a planet rotates, the longer it’s length of day.....

This guide is for lenders and consumers who need information about nationwide financing programs for solar energy systems. It was prepared by Patrina Eiffert, They helped to ensure that it contains the most up-to-date information possible....sing solar energy systems to provide heat and electricity for the nation’s buildings helps to conserve our fossil fuel resources and reduce our reliance on imported fuels. Because solar energy systems do not emit harmful pollutants, they also help protect the environment. The Borrower’s Guide to Financing Solar Energy Systems: A Federal Overview provides information that can assist both lenders and consumers in financing solar energy systems, which include both solar electric (photovoltaic) and solar thermal systems. This guide also includes information about other ways to make solar energy systems more affordable, as well as descriptions of special mortgage programs for energy-efficient homes. Although the sun’s energy is free, special equipment is needed to convert it to electricity or heat for a building. The up-front costs of this equipment can be daunting to consumers and a barrier to new purchases. Therefore, this guide was prepared to show how today’s solar energy systems can be affordably financed....
